Community Health Coordinator

JOB SUMMARY:

The Community Health Coordinator is responsible for recruiting, enrolling, and supporting pregnant and up to 12 months postpartum clients. The Community Health Worker provides care coordination, support, planning and community referrals to program participants and their families.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ITES:

• Recruit and enroll women in need of prenatal care, and support services via community canvassing and other outreach efforts.

• Assist in the identification of families at risk for infant morbidity, particularly where the child shows signs of failure-to-thrive, abuse and neglect.

• Conduct home visits at client's residents for women enrolled in the program to provide health education and facilitate risk reduction activities.

• Develop realistic and attainable goal plans with family to address child development and social and emotional growth as well as parent/child bonding and positive interactions.

• Assist parents in developing formal and informal community supports.

• Make referrals to appropriate medical or social service agencies and resources according to participant needs and risk factors. Follow up on all referrals.

• Conduct assessments on clients and infants at appropriate intervals.

• Plan, implement, and facilitate parenting education activities using an evidenced based curriculum.

• Participate in community activities and events while encouraging participants to attend as well.

• Maintain a set caseload, which may fluctuate, based on funding.

• Act as an advocate for clients.

• Travel throughout service area required.

• Complete and maintain paperwork, reports and records as required meeting all deadlines, in order to comply with audits of computer and paper files.

• Exemplify positive role modeling by professionalism, language, work ethic and positive communication.

• Perform other duties as assigned.
